Date: Saturday January 17th, 2026
Tipoff: 3 p.m. (central)
Location: Welsh-Ryan Arena (Evanston, Ill)
TV/Online:
Saturday’s game will be broadcast on BTN with Chris Vosters and Brian Butch on the call. It will also be available online on the FOX Sports and FOX Sports 1 apps.
Radio:
Saturday’s game will be carried on the Huskers Radio Network with Kent Pavelka and Jeff Smith on the call, including KLIN (1400 AM) in Lincoln, KCRO (660 AM) and KIBM (1490 AM) in Omaha and KRVN (880 AM) in Lexington. The pregame show begins an hour before tipoff and will also be available on Huskers.com and the Huskers app.
Jarek’s Pre-Tipoff Thoughts:
This one is pretty straightforward in my opinion, stop Nick Martinelli and you stop Northwestern. WAY EASIER SAID THAN DONE. Martinelli has been a burden on the Huskers defense in his time in Evanston, and he currently is tied for the nation’s lead with 23.8 points per game. Martinelli is a 3-point guy who can shoot from anywhere. He is a slightly better version of Pryce Sandfort.
Outside of that, Northwestern is winless in conference play. They’ve been in some close games, but other than that, there really isn’t much to write home about. The fear factor with this Wildcats team isn’t the same now that Boo Buie finally graduated. Having said that, it’s still very tough to win on the road. Nebraska does a great job of taking things one game at a time, and this one is most assuredly no different.
The Huskers game plan remains the same, move the ball, shoot a ton of 3’s, and play stifling interior defense that forces plenty of outside shots. Nebraska has proven it can be one of the best teams in the country when it does all three at the same time but is still pretty good when it does two. I think Nebraska stays undefeated. Score Prediction: Nebraska 81 Northwestern 75
